Cheesy Jalapeno Garlic Bread

Gooey cheesy garlic bread full of spicy garlic jalapeño flavor! The perfect side dish.
Prep Time15 minutes
Cook Time15 minutes
Total Time30 minutes
Course: Appetizer, Side Dish
Cuisine: American
Servings: 6 servings
Author: Dorothy Kern
Cost: $15

Ingredients

  • 1 (16 oz) loaf French bread
  • ½ cup butter , softened
  • 4 cloves garlic
  • 2 jalapeños , divided
  • 1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
  • 1 cup shredded pepper jack cheese

Instructions

  • Preheat the oven to 400°F. Line a cookie sheet with foil or parchment.
  • Slice the French bread horizontally, creating two long halves.
  • Dice one jalapeño small. Slice the remaining jalapeño into thin slices.
  • Add butter to a medium size bowl. Use a garlic press to press the garlic into the butter. Add diced jalapeño and stir together.
  • Spread butter evenly on both halves of the bread. Top with both cheeses. Place sliced jalapeños evenly on top.
  • Bake for 10-15 minutes or until the cheese is bubbly and slightly golden.
  • Remove from the oven, allow to cool slightly and cut into slices.
